Organizing Made Easy
One of the killer features of Gallery - Photo Album is its organizing capabilities. You can create albums with just a few taps. The app even suggests albums based on locations and dates, which is a neat touch. It’s like it reads your mind and knows exactly how your brain wants things sorted. Plus, the search function is on point. Looking for that one photo from last summer? Just type in a few keywords, and boom, there it is!

Privacy and Sharing
Privacy is a big deal these days, right? This app gets it. There’s a nifty option to create a secure folder where you can stash away your private photos. It’s password-protected, so no more worries about prying eyes. When it’s time to share, the app has got you covered. Sharing to social media or sending photos to friends is seamless. You can even share entire albums with just a couple of taps.
